Hot Water Generator – An Efficient and Instant Solution

A Hot Water Generator is a reliable and cost-effective solution for producing hot water instantly. It is ideal for applications where quick and consistent hot water is essential.

Instatherm hot water generator is a fully-packaged, silent, and instant hot water generator designed to meet the specific needs of industries such as hotels, hospitals, resorts, swimming pools, dairies, laundries, and various process industries.

Hot Water Generators are available in both pressurized and non-pressurized models, depending on the required water temperature:

  • For water temperatures below 100°C, a non-pressurized system is sufficient, as water boils at 100°C under normal atmospheric pressure.
  • For water temperatures above 100°C, a pressurized system is required. The pressure is determined by the desired outlet temperature along with appropriate safety margins.

Hot Water Generator Design & Construction (Instatherm Design)

Our Instatherm Hot Water Generators are engineered with utmost safety and performance in mind. Each unit is equipped with a safety valve mounted at the top of the shell to ensure that the internal pressure never exceeds the design limit.

Our hot water generation systems, Instatherm features a shell and tube, smoke tube design, which is ideal for larger capacities. For smaller capacity applications, a coil type, water tube design is also available.

To enhance thermal efficiency, the system is designed with multiple flue gas passes, ensuring better heat transfer and lower operational costs.

    A Hot Water Generator is an industrial heating system designed to produce hot water at controlled temperatures and low pressure. It is a safer and energy-efficient alternative to steam boilers in applications where steam is not required.

    Boilers generate steam at high pressures, while Hot Water Generators supply hot water only, making them suitable for low to medium temperature applications. They are easier to operate, safer, and require less maintenance than steam boilers.

    A Hot Water Generator is an industrial heating system designed to produce hot water instantly without the need for storage. It works by transferring heat from fuel combustion to water through a heat exchanger, ensuring continuous and efficient hot water supply.

    A non-pressurized system operates below 100°C at atmospheric pressure and is suitable for general applications like laundries and hotels.
    A pressurized system is used for temperatures above 100°C, where pressure is required to raise the boiling point, making it ideal for process industries such as pharmaceuticals and chemicals.

    Yes, for applications requiring only hot water, a Hot Water Generator is more efficient than a steam boiler because:

    • It eliminates steam-related losses
    • Requires less maintenance
    • Offers faster response time
    • Consumes less fuel for the same application

    Being a fully packaged system, installation is quick and straightforward. Most systems can be installed and commissioned with minimal site work, reducing downtime and project delays.

    Maintenance requirements are relatively low and include:

    • Periodic cleaning of heat transfer surfaces
    • Fuel system inspection
    • Checking pumps and controls
    • Basic water quality monitoring

    Proper maintenance ensures long-term efficiency and trouble-free operation.
